Getting There
-
Car
If you are driving from Colombo, head south on Galle Road (A2) towards Moratuwa. Continue on Galle Road until you reach Moratuwa. Once in Moratuwa, turn left onto Bandaranayake Mawatha. Kaju Kale will be on your right. There is no specific parking area, so you may need to find street parking nearby. Please note that traffic can be heavy, especially during peak hours, so plan accordingly.
-
Public Transportation - Bus
From the Colombo Central Bus Stand, take a bus heading towards Moratuwa. Buses that go along Galle Road will stop in Moratuwa. Once you arrive at Moratuwa, get off at the nearest stop to Bandaranayake Mawatha. From there, walk towards Bandaranayake Mawatha, and Kaju Kale will be on your right. The bus fare is usually around 50 LKR, but this may vary slightly based on the bus company.
-
Public Transportation - Train
Take a train from Colombo Fort Station to Moratuwa Station. The journey takes approximately 30 minutes. Upon arrival at Moratuwa Station, exit the station and head towards Galle Road. From there, you can either walk or take a tuk-tuk to Bandaranayake Mawatha. Kaju Kale is located along Bandaranayake Mawatha, and you should be able to reach it in about 15 minutes by foot or a short tuk-tuk ride. Train tickets cost around 50-100 LKR depending on the type of train.
-
Tuk-tuk
If you prefer a more direct route, you can hire a tuk-tuk from anywhere in Colombo District. Just tell the driver to take you to Kaju Kale on Bandaranayake Mawatha in Moratuwa. The cost for a tuk-tuk ride from Colombo to Moratuwa is usually between 1,000 to 1,500 LKR depending on your starting point and traffic conditions.
